     Delenn   //   The One Who Is       (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-20)
As a member of the Grey Council, Delenn was in the innermost circle of the Minbari government, but she chose to keep that fact a secret when she went to Babylon 5.
Mindful of the prophecy that humans and Minbari would have to come together to win the war ahead, Delenn underwent a transformation that not only gave her partly-human features, it altered her on the genetic level, making her both a symbolic and literal bridge between the two races.
After Earth's own civil war came to an end, Delenn and John Sheridan, the Captain of Babylon 5 and the newly elected President of the Interstellar Alliance, were married aboard their ship, the White Star, and glimpses into the future revealed that they had a son, whom they named David.

 Babylon 5 Encyclopedia: Data Display   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-20)
Delenn was appointed as Minbari Ambassador by the Grey Council of which she is a member.
Originally appointed to Babylon 5 to monitor Sinclair (and under order to kill him if he remembers his capture at the Battle of the Line), she saw a greater purpose, as part of a prophecy foretold by Valen.
This angered the Grey Council, thinking she is herself trying to become part of a prophecy, resulting in her replacement on the Council.
